§ 1111A.024 — PENALTIES
IN § 1111A.024Title 7. LIFE INSURANCE AND ANNUITIES · Part A. LIFE INSURANCE IN GENERAL · Ch. 1111A. LIFE SETTLEMENT CONTRACTS
Statute text
View on source(a)It is a violation of this chapter for any person, provider, broker, or any other party related to the business of life settlements to commit a fraudulent life settlement act.
(b)A person who knowingly, recklessly, or intentionally commits a fraudulent life settlement act commits a criminal offense and is subject to penalties under Chapter 35, Penal Code.
(c)Subtitle B, Title 2, applies to a violation of this chapter.
Legislative history
Added by Acts 2011, 82nd Leg., R.S., Ch. 1156 (H.B. 2277), Sec. 3, eff. September 1, 2011.
